Maintenance Commands
update
Update system packages via apt:
Updates package lists
Shows upgradable packages
Requires confirmation before upgrading
Reports if reboot is needed
Dry run:
./skill.sh update --dry-runshows what would be updated
clean
Clean up system to free disk space:
Removes unused packages (autoremove)
Clears package cache
Cleans old journal logs (keeps 7 days)
Optionally cleans Docker artifacts
Shows space saved
Dry run:
./skill.sh clean --dry-runshows what would be cleaned
reboot
Graceful system reboot:
10-second countdown
Ctrl+C to cancel
Uses systemctl reboot
Dry run:
./skill.sh reboot --dry-runshows countdown without rebooting
restart-gateway
Restart the Clawdis Gateway service:
Stops all running gateway processes
Starts fresh gateway on port 18789
Confirms port is listening
Shows access URLs
Dry run:
./skill.sh restart-gateway --dry-runshows what would happen
optimize
Apply safe system optimizations:
Disable Bluetooth service (~50MB RAM saved)
Disable ModemManager (~30MB RAM saved)
Disable Avahi/Zeroconf (~20MB RAM saved)
Set swappiness to 10 (better RAM utilization)
Dry run:
./skill.sh optimize --dry-runshows what would changeUndo:
./skill.sh optimize --undoreverts all changes
Total RAM savings: ~100MB
Reversibility: Yes, use --undo flag to revert
Note: All maintenance commands require sudo and ask for confirmation before making changes. Use --dry-run flag to preview changes without applying them.
